Allows reuse when defining kotlinc versions. Supporting multiple plugin apis will require supporting multiple kotlincs.
Managing multiple kotlinc version increases toil. To simplify things, introduce a centralized list of the support versions of kotlinc. Success for this is predicated on the plugin api remaining stable on point releases, which is anecdotally true.
This provides a separate plugin for each major kotlinc release. Still requires wiring into the toolchain system (follow up PR), but simplifies using older versions of kotlin with less effort.
Current stardoc cannot seem to handle dynamic key in dictionary comprehensions. The simple solution is to separate the KOTLINC_INDEX from the compiler repository definition. Has the added benefit of keeping development logic from production logic.

Part one of two.
@nkoroste discovered we had been breaking backwards compatibility by updating the plugins as the compiler plugin api changes.
These separates and compiles each major version of the compiler plugins. The follow up pr will choose the correct plugin for the toolchain -- separating the efforts made sense form a complexity and limiting the scope of the PR point of view.
